4

GIS シェープファイルをインタラクティブに表示できるパッケージはありますか? シンプルなシェープファイル (海岸線など) を表示するシンプルな GUI を作成しようとしていますが、どこから始めればよいかわかりません。私はもともとRでこれを行うことを任されていましたが、pythonとQtを試してみたいと思っています.

4

2 に答える 2

2

Mapnikは GIS シェープ ファイルをサポートし、Python インターフェイスを備えています。

于 2012-08-08T18:51:33.113 に答える
0

ファイルの読み取りにはshapefileライブラリを、データのすべての処理にはshapelyを組み合わせて使用​​できると思います。

shapelyポイントとポリゴンのデータを操作するために、データベースに読み込まれた地理データ フィードを操作するために使用しました。

コメントによると、PyQt アプリでシェープファイルを単純に表示したい場合は、実際に必要なのは、それを SVG に変換して直接表示することだけです。私はこの変換ライブラリを使用していませんが、似たようなものは他にもあると確信しています。次に、QSvgWidgetを使用してロードして表示できます

于 2012-08-09T19:34:05.857 に答える